CNC capability criteria depend on the drawing, customer requirement, study purpose, and production condition. Machine-capability and serial-production studies must not be treated as interchangeable.
How do tool wear, thermal growth and fixture repeatability actually erode CNC capability between the warm-up part and the last part of a tool life?
Use the approved drawing, purchase order, customer quality agreement, Control Plan, and study method. Numerical values are program-specific. Common examples—only when specified—include:
CNC capability is dominated by drift, not random spread. Machine capability (Cm/Cmk) on short runs almost always looks excellent; process capability across a full tool life, thermal cycle and fixture reload is where reality appears. Customer targets are typically defined by the end-customer CSR (automotive, aerospace, medical) — CNC itself has no universal capability standard.
The drawing, purchase order and customer acceptance criteria determine required evidence.
Scope: Machined supplied parts.
Verify: Approved drawing, purchase order, customer quality agreement and control plan.
Separate machine capability setup studies from serial-production capability.
Assess tool wear, thermal drift, fixture repeatability, offset strategy and measurement-system suitability.
